Police Ride-along Program
Are you interested in experiencing what it is like to be a police officer? The NIU Police Department offers a ride-along to the public to see firsthand what being a police officer is really like.

Internships
College students enroll in our eight-week internship and gain valuable experience to prepare for a career in law enforcement.
First Aid and CPR
We certify community members in first aid and CPR through the American Heart Association. This is especially helpful to NIU students going into the medical field.
Police Community Relations
PCRs are informational programs offered to the public by the NIU Department of Police and Public Safety on a variety of topics.
A.L.I.C.E. Violent Intruder Training
The NIU Department of Police and Public Safety proactively teaches the A.L.I.C.E. concepts to mentally prepare our community for attacks by a violent intruder. These training seminars instill self-defense skills and confidence in participants.
